ByteArrayOutputStream或ByteArrayInputStream不須要關閉流緣由分析

在完深度拷貝的時候看到了這個  帖子https://blog.csdn.net/xiaolin_yxl/article/details/78879660數組

我才留到 沒有close , 原來還有 這種狀況的哦!.net

ByteArrayOutputStream或ByteArrayInputStream是內存讀寫流,不一樣於指向硬盤的流,它內部是使用字節數組讀內存的,這個字節數組是它的成員變量,當這個數組再也不使用變成垃圾的時候,Java的垃圾回收機制會將它回收。因此不須要關流。blog

相關文章
相關標籤/搜索